构建Ansible分发的工具
项目描述
Pygments词法和样式Ansible片段
本项目提供了一种Pygments词法,能够处理Ansible输出。它可以在Pygments集成的任何地方使用。词法在全局范围内注册为ansible-output
。
它还提供了一种Pygments样式,用于需要突出显示代码片段的工具。
该代码根据 BSD 2-Clause 许可协议 许可。
在 Sphinx 中使用 lexer
请确保此库已安装在与您的 Sphinx 自动化相同的环境中,通过 pip install ansible-pygments sphinx
。然后,您应该能够在 RST 文档的代码块中使用名为 ansible-output
的 lexer。例如
.. code-block:: ansible-output
[WARNING]: Unable to find '/nosuchfile' in expected paths (use -vvvvv to see paths)
ok: [localhost] => {
"msg": ""
}
在 Sphinx 中使用样式
只需在 conf.py
中设置 ansible
即可,如果此项目如上所示与 Sphinx 一起安装,则它将“正常工作”。
pygments_style = 'ansible'
项目详情
下载文件
下载适合您平台的应用程序。如果您不确定要选择哪个,请了解有关 安装包 的更多信息。
源代码分发
ansible-pygments-0.1.1.tar.gz (8.4 kB 查看哈希值)